Nuada

Pinterest


Origin: Celtic

Meaning: an Irish masculine name possibly meaning either "protector" or "fog".

I've also seen it listed as possibly being related to a Germanic root word meaning "acquire, have the use of".

In Irish mythology, Nuada Airgetlám (Nuada of the Silver Arm) was king of the Tuatha Dé Danann who lost his arm in battle and which was later replaced by a silver one.

I've heard it pronounced noo-a-da or noo-a-tha


Variants:
  • Nuadha 
  • Nudd (Welsh)
